South Beach Park, Boca Raton Neighborhood

South Beach Park offers a charming neighborhood with a variety of housing options, including spacious apartment buildings and single detached homes primarily built during the 1960s and 1970s. The area features a network of well-maintained streets that facilitate comfortable car travel and abundant parking availability. A selection of local restaurants provides convenient dining options close by. Green spaces are plentiful, providing peaceful outdoor areas suitable for relaxation and recreation. The neighborhood also benefits from a solid cycling infrastructure with gentle terrain. Bus services are accessible within short distances, supporting alternative transportation needs. Quiet streets contribute to a calm and inviting environment throughout the area.

South Beach Park offers a broad selection of green spaces to enjoy. There are a few public green spaces nearby for residents to visit, like SOUTH BEACH PARK, and they are especially well-distributed, which makes them easy to get to. Highlights of South Beach Park

Parks, schools, dining, and what makes this neighborhood special

🌊 South Beach Park

Stretching along A1A, South Beach Park is a pristine oceanfront destination featuring walking trails, picnic areas, lifeguard-supervised swimming, and direct beach access, making it the heart of outdoor recreation and relaxation for the neighborhood.

🚶 The Boca Raton Historical Walking Trail

This scenic, self-guided walking trail runs through the historic beachfront neighborhoods near South Beach Park, offering interpretive signs and a glimpse into Boca Raton’s rich architectural and cultural past.

☕ Camino Real Café Strip

Just steps from the park entrance on East Camino Real, a cozy row of cafés and eateries offers locals and visitors a delightful spot for breakfast, brunch, or artisanal coffee with gorgeous sea breezes and friendly service.

🏞️ Red Reef Park

Located just north of South Beach Park on North Ocean Boulevard, Red Reef Park is renowned for its snorkeling reef, lush landscaping, family picnic spots, and the Gumbo Limbo Nature Center nearby, enhancing the area’s outdoor lifestyle.

🛶 South Inlet Park & Jetty

At the southern end of the neighborhood, South Inlet Park boasts a vibrant fishing jetty, shaded playgrounds, scenic boardwalks, and unique views where the Boca Raton Inlet meets the Atlantic—perfect for sunrise strolls or spotting boats and marine life.
